Literature

CARP interacts with titin at a unique helical N2A sequence and at the domain Ig81 to form a structured complex.

Zhou, T.Fleming, J.R.Franke, B.Bogomolovas, J.Barsukov, I.Rigden, D.J.Labeit, S.Mayans, O.

(2016) FEBS Lett 590: 3098-3110

  • DOI: https://doi.org/10.1002/1873-3468.12362
  • Primary Citation of Related Structures:  
    5JOE

  • PubMed Abstract: 

    The cardiac ankyrin repeat protein (CARP) is up-regulated in the myocardium during cardiovascular disease and in response to mechanical or toxic stress. Stress-induced CARP interacts with the N2A spring region of the titin filament to modulate muscle compliance. We characterize the interaction between CARP and titin-N2A and show that the binding site in titin spans the dual domain UN2A-Ig81. We find that the unique sequence UN2A is not structurally disordered, but that it has a stable, elongated α-helical fold that possibly acts as a constant force spring. Our findings portray CARP/titin-N2A as a structured node and help to rationalize the molecular basis of CARP mechanosensing in the sarcomeric I-band.
